Vice President Joe Biden and Sen. Bernie Sanders named the co-chairs and members of their joint task forces — including AOC and SecState John Kerry as Co-Chairs on Climate Change. The task forces “will meet in advance of the Democratic National Convention to make recommendations to the DNC Platform Committee” and to Biden directly. 

From Politico:
Biden said in a statement that a “united party is key to defeating” the president in six months, as well as “moving our country forward through an unprecedented crisis.” The task forces “will be essential to identifying ways to build on our progress and not simply turn the clock back to a time before Donald Trump, but transform our country,” he said.

“In the midst of the unprecedented economic and pandemic crises we face, the Democratic Party must think big, act boldly, and fight to change the direction of this country,” Sanders said in his statement, adding: “I commend Joe Biden for working together with my campaign to assemble a group of leading thinkers and activists who can and will unify our party in a transformational and progressive direction.”

POLITICAL COMMENTATOR, AUTHOR, ACTIVIST:
ROBERT REICH
Friday May 29th, 2020 @ 5PM France  
RSVP here

Robert Reich’s political and government experience spans decades, including serving on President Barack Obama's economic transition advisory board and four years as Secretary of Labor under President Bill Clinton. A prolific and bestselling author, Reich has published more than a dozen books and has co-created two award-winning Netflix documentaries, Inequality for All and Saving Capitalism. His new book, The System: Who Rigged It, and How We Fix It analyses how we came to the current fraught economic and political situation, and how we can change the system to serve the many rather than the elite few.
